随着业务的扩展和技术的升级,可能需要从一个数据库系统迁移到另一个系统,或在本地和云端之间进行数据同步。特别是在信创国产化背景下,使用开源数据库 MySQL 的企业越来越多,这就涉及到了解数据库转换工具有哪些,以及MySQL 怎么导入 SQL 文件?
MySQL 怎么导入 SQL 文件
导入 SQL 文件是一项常见的操作通常用于恢复备份数据、迁移数据库或初始化新环境。以下是几种常见的导入方法:
1. 使用命令行工具
MySQL 提供了强大的命令行工具,可以通过简单的命令导入 SQL 文件。例如,使用 mysql -u 用户名 -p 数据库名 < 文件名.sql 命令,就可以将 SQL 文件导入到指定的数据库中。这种方法简单快捷,适合有一定命令行操作经验的用户。
2. 通过图形界面工具
对于不熟悉命令行操作的用户,可以使用 MySQL Workbench 等图形界面工具。这些工具提供了友好的操作界面,用户可以通过菜单选项轻松导入 SQL 文件,无需记忆复杂的命令。
3. 利用 PHPMyAdmin
如果你的数据库托管在服务器上,且通过 PHPMyAdmin 管理,那么也可以通过该工具导入 SQL 文件。只需登录 PHPMyAdmin,选择目标数据库,然后在导入选项中选择 SQL 文件即可。
数据库转换工具有哪些选择
在数据迁移和转换过程中,选择合适的工具可以大大提高效率。不同的工具适用于不同的场景,以下是一些常见的数据库转换工具:
1. MySQL Workbench
MySQL Workbench 是一个功能强大的数据库设计和管理工具,它不仅支持 SQL 文件的导入和导出,还可以进行数据库的迁移和转换。它提供了直观的图形界面,帮助用户轻松完成复杂的数据库操作。
2. Fast SQL Translate
在一些特殊场景下,可能需要更专业的工具来完成数据库的转换。例如,当涉及到跨数据库系统的复杂迁移时,栎偲Fast SQL Translate 这款 SQL 语句实时翻译引擎可以提供强大的支持。它能够实时翻译 SQL 语句,帮助用户快速完成从一种数据库系统到另一种系统的转换。这种工具在处理复杂的 SQL 语句和数据结构时表现出色,尤其适合企业级的数据库迁移项目。